Russia-Ukraine war live: Moscow says Kyiv plot to kill high-ranking officer with music speaker bomb foiled

Claim from FSB comes two weeks after Ukrainian assassination of senior Russian general Igor Kirillov

Russia has lost 784,200 troops in Ukraine since the beginning of its full-scale invasion on 24 February 2022, the General Staff of Ukraine’s Armed Forces reported. This number includes 1,690 Russian casualties over the past day.

Russia has also lost:

9,651 tanks

19,970 armored fighting vehicles

21,408 artillery systems

32,328 vehicles and fuel tanks

1,256 multiple launch rocket systems

1032 air defence systems

369 aircraft

329 helicopters

21,013 drones

28 ships and boats

1 submarine
